How Are Visual Alerts Incorporated into Smart Home Solutions?

Visual alert systems constitute crucial components of smart homes, particularly for individuals with hearing loss. These systems provide alternative cues for sound-based notifications, ensuring that essential signals—like doorbells, alarms, or phone calls—are perceivable through visual means. Generally, these systems employ flashing lights or notifications on smart displays to alert users about significant events.

For example, a smart smoke detector can be programmed to flash lights in response to alarm activation, ensuring that the user is alerted without relying on sound. Moreover, these alerts can be integrated with smartphones, allowing users to receive notifications directly on their devices, regardless of their location within the home. This level of integration not only enhances situational awareness but also fosters a safer living environment for individuals with hearing impairments.

How Do Smart Locks Enhance Security for Individuals with Hearing Impairments?

Smart locks significantly bolster home security by offering keyless entry and remote access capabilities, which are particularly advantageous for individuals with hearing loss. These locks can be controlled via smartphones or voice commands, enabling users to manage their home security visually. For example, users can receive notifications when someone approaches their door, allowing them to visually verify their identity without needing to hear a knock or doorbell.

The integration of security features, such as real-time alerts and the ability to grant remote access to visitors, enhances safety while simplifying home access management. Furthermore, many smart locks come equipped with visual indicators that confirm entry or locking status, ensuring that individuals with hearing loss can feel confident in the security measures of their home.

How Do Smart Smoke and Carbon Monoxide Detectors Ensure Safety?

Smart smoke and carbon monoxide detectors are essential for ensuring safety in homes, especially for individuals with hearing loss. These detectors leverage advanced technology to deliver alerts through visual and vibrational signals, ensuring that users are immediately aware of potential hazards. Unlike traditional detectors that rely solely on auditory alarms, smart detectors integrate flashing lights and other visual cues to effectively signal danger.

In emergency situations, these smart detectors can send notifications to smartphones and other devices, ensuring that individuals receive alerts regardless of their location within the home. This integration facilitates timely responses, significantly increasing the chances of safety during critical events. By equipping homes with these advanced detectors, individuals with hearing loss can enjoy greater peace of mind, knowing they are safeguarded against unseen dangers.
